Output 66284bf69652f2cba66c9dbfcd75a98f52c82e79b48890265d4af60070523fa8:0

value
756455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ec88b3bcfbcc504de7ebd91578c8722037c27d6 OP_EQUAL
address
3BnnVgHvGFnRgWw7phpW4tvrYSjocj7EbR
transaction
66284bf69652f2cba66c9dbfcd75a98f52c82e79b48890265d4af60070523fa8
spent
true